Just wanted to see if people use dropper rigs for crappie and whats their favorite....mine is a small kastmaster with a 6lbs floro. leader about 3-5in. long and a size 10 mamooska or diamond jig tipped with spikes or plastic. I also do well with perch with this, when they are looking for the flash but don't bite a spoon.
